二进制数11001000为十进制数的200,这儿有两段,前一段表示释放次数的上限,后一段表示剩余的释放次数。二进制数10100为十进制数的20,表示20级的魔法。最前面两个零是补位用的,最后面的一个零,则是为技能代码进位用的。这样分析,我们可以知道,释放次数上限和剩余次数max=255,魔法最高级别为max=31,若我们需要释放31级的魔法255次,则其二进制代码为:
0 0 | 1 1 1 1 1 1 1 1 | 1 1 1 1 1 1 1 1 | 1 1 1 1 1 | 0
化为16进制数为:
3F FF FE
放入内存为 FE FF 3F,即是上面代码段中的 YY ZZ WW段。
。
(kerling注:以下以角色等级决定的魔法属性,其后四字节的属性值是代表一个基数,基数值越大,在相同等级时所拥有能力值就高。所有的基数max=63。)
D6 +? 防御 (以角色等级决定)
D7 +?% 防御强化 (以角色等级决定)
D8 +? 体力 (以角色等级决定) (格式为 D8 00 00 00 | 00 XX 00 00)(注: 不能用在武器上)
D9 +? 法力 (以角色等级决定) (格式为 D9 00 00 00 | 00 XX 00 00) (注: 不能用在武器上)
DA +? 最大伤害值 (以角色等级决定)
<< 上一页 [11] [12] [13] [14] 下一页